The Allure of Lamé Fabric
Lamé (pronounced lah-MAY) is a fabric woven or knit with metallic yarns, typically gold or silver, though contemporary versions come in every hue imaginable. What sets lamé apart from other shiny fabrics is its unique ability to reflect light while maintaining comfort and wearability. Designers love working with lamé because it drapes beautifully and creates stunning silhouettes that flatter every body type.

Styling Your Lamé Dress
The key to wearing lamé successfully lies in balancing its inherent drama. For evening events, pair a gold or silver lamé dress with simple accessories – think nude pumps and delicate jewelry. This lets the dress take center stage. Daytime lamé looks work best when the metallic element is more subdued, perhaps in a floral pattern with metallic threads or as subtle trim details.
Many fashion-forward women are discovering that party dresses in lamé fabrics offer an excellent alternative to traditional sequin or satin options. The fabric provides similar glamour without the weight or potential for snagging that comes with sequins.
Lamé Dresses for Every Body Type
One of the greatest advantages of lamé is how universally flattering it can be. For pear-shaped figures, A-line lamé dresses highlight the waist while skimming over the hips. Hourglass figures shine in fitted lamé sheaths that follow the body’s natural curves. Apple shapes can opt for empire waist lamé gowns that drape beautifully over the midsection.
When shopping for evening dresses, consider how different lamé textures can affect the overall look. Crinkled lamé offers a more casual, boho vibe, while smooth lamé reads as ultra-glamorous. Some contemporary versions even incorporate stretch for improved comfort and fit.
Caring for Your Lamé Garments
To keep your lamé dresses looking their best, always check the care label. Many lamé garments require hand washing or delicate dry cleaning to preserve the metallic fibers. Store them flat or on padded hangers to prevent stretching, and avoid folding to prevent permanent creases in the metallic coating.
